cube:evk
Your V2X Platform
The cube:evk is a V2X and edge-AI development platform for automotive, smart mobility, and connected robotics applications. It is built around the i.MX8MP SoC, with a quad-core Arm Cortex-A53 CPU, an integrated 2.3 TOPS NPU for AI inference acceleration, and hardware-accelerated multimedia and security blocks. The cube:evk targets ETSI ITS-G5 and C-V2X applications.
The cube platform unifies several subsystems:
cube:radio
Direct V2X link-layer access for ITS-G5 and C-V2X. Send/receive frames with full control over power, data rate, and channel parameters.
cube:its
ROS 2-based ITS framework with CAM, DENM, CPM, and VAM facilities. Full ETSI compliance in a familiar ROS 2 environment.
cube:ubx
High-rate GNSS/IMU fusion access. Get position, velocity, heading, and dead-reckoning data from the on-board u-blox receiver.
cube:rpc
Remote Procedure Calls for controlling your cube over the network. Build clients in any Cap'n Proto-supported language.
The cube:evk combines V2X communication, precision positioning, edge AI, network-based communication, and open-source ITS protocols on a single platform. Network connectivity covers Ethernet, Wi-Fi, Bluetooth, LTE, and CAN/CAN-FD for backend, V2N, and in-vehicle integration. It targets autonomous vehicles, smart infrastructure, and connected robotics systems.
